`
xixinfei
  • 浏览: 414148 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

Eclipse的目录结构

 
阅读更多

EOS Studio其实是在Eclipse上做的拓展,今天回家顺手拿了本《Eclipse权威开发指南》特意找到感兴趣的部分看了一下,结合EOS Studio下的目录结构,现记录分析如下。

Eclipse根目录下重要目录和文件:

         configuration目录:

活动配置文件的默认位置。该文件夹中的config.ini文件对所安装的Eclipse的活动产品配置进行了定义。Config.ini文件在启动Eclipse时会被预加载。

         features目录:

该目录中含有众多子目录。Eclipse中已经安装的每个功能部件都对应于这样一个子目录。每个功能部件都会引用一个或多个这样的插件。

         plugins目录:

该目录中含有众多子目录。Eclipse中已经安装的每个插件对应于这样的一个子目录。

         readme目录:

该目录中含有一个名为readme_eclipse.html文件。

         jre目录:

该目录中含有供Eclipse使用的默认Java运行时环境。

         workspace目录:

该目录中存放工作区间的数据。

         .eclipseproduct文件:

该文件标识出在自己所处目录中含有一个基于Eclipse的产品。

         Cpl-v10.html文件:

Eclipse通用公共许可证。

         Eclipse.exe文件:

Eclipse启动的可执行文件。

         notice.html文件:

Eclipse.org软件用户协议。

         Startup.jar文件:

用于帮助Eclipse启动的Java运行时代码。

以下是几点补充:

      Configuration\org.eclipse.update\platform.xml保存了安装Eclipse的配置信息,包括安装位置以及Eclipse启动时哪些功能部件可用和有效。Eclipse Update Manager负责对上述信息进行管理。

      Eclipse会对features目录进行搜索,以找出那些含有名为feature.xml文件的子目录。如果features目录下某一子目录没有featrue.xml文件,那么上述查找操作就会忽略掉该子目录,反之如果找到,那么该文件将会被作为一个安装位置来处理。

       Plugins目录下每个子目录名为插件id+插件版本。

 

分享到:
评论

相关推荐

    Eclipse简介,Eclipse安装与使用,目录结构,开发环境,项目构建,Eclipse常用快捷键,提示和技巧

    Eclipse的工作区目录结构包括项目、工作集、首选项等。每个项目包含源代码、资源文件、构建路径、类路径等信息。默认的目录结构如下: - `.metadata`: 存储Eclipse工作区的元数据。 - `src`: 源代码目录。 - `...

    idea导出文件支持目录结构jar包

    idea导出文件类似eclipse目录结构,将jar包放在idea目录的plugins下,重启idea右键Export Files。

    java eclipse 插件 按照目录结构生成的目录树

    通过上述组件的组合,"java eclipse 插件 按照目录结构生成的目录树"提供了一个高效的工作环境,使开发者能够在复杂的项目中快速定位并管理代码。这个插件不仅提高了开发效率,还提升了代码的可维护性和组织性。

    eclipse安装插件的方法

    解压插件文件,确保插件目录结构正确,通常需要在插件目录下建立`eclipse`子目录,然后在`eclipse`子目录中建立`plugins`和`features`两个文件夹。 2. **创建链接文件** 在Eclipse安装目录下的`links`文件夹中...

    Eclipse-java-neon中文语言包

    在Eclipse目录结构中,"dropins"目录是用于放置插件的地方。 5. **重启Eclipse**:关闭Eclipse(如果正在运行),然后重新启动。Eclipse应该会自动检测到新添加的语言包,并在启动时应用中文界面。 6. **确认设置*...

    Android\eclipse3.7.0汉化包

    对于不熟悉Eclipse目录结构的用户,可能需要查阅教程或官方文档来确保正确安装。 在使用汉化包时,开发者需要注意以下几点: 1. 确保Eclipse版本与汉化包兼容。不同的Eclipse版本可能会有不同的UI布局或功能,因此...

    eclipse打开目录插件

    总之,"eclipse打开目录插件"是Eclipse开发环境中提高效率的实用工具,借助Java Desktop API实现了跨平台支持,让开发者能更便捷地管理和访问项目中的目录结构。通过熟练掌握并利用这样的工具,开发者可以更好地专注...

    Eclipse中文语言包安装和设置中文

    - 解压下载好的中文语言包,找到与Eclipse目录结构匹配的文件夹。 - 将这些文件夹复制到Eclipse的相应目录中。 - 重启Eclipse完成安装。 ##### 2. 使用Links目录统一管理插件 这种方法虽然操作稍微复杂,但能更好地...

    Eclipse的插件安装方法

    - 插件目录结构需与Eclipse中的结构一致,Eclipse启动时会自动识别链接的插件。 3. **update安装** update安装是通过网络进行的,用户只需知道插件的更新地址,Eclipse会自动处理下载和安装过程,同时还能检查...

    eclipse体系结构图、项目组成图

    本篇文章将深入解析Eclipse的体系结构以及项目的组成,帮助读者理解其内部工作原理。 **Eclipse体系结构** Eclipse的体系结构主要基于插件模型,这使得它具有高度的模块化和可扩展性。Eclipse的核心是Platform ...

    Eclipse的体系结构.pdf

    Eclipse 的体系结构是 Eclipse 平台的核心组成部分,它提供了一个可扩展的集成开发环境平台,让开发者可以轻松地开发出新的工具和插件。 Eclipse 平台的体系结构主要由三个部分组成:平台运行时系统(Platform ...

    Eclipse解压01主目录

    总结来说,"Eclipse解压01主目录"提供了Eclipse的基础结构,包括启动文件、许可协议、配置信息和插件管理等核心部分。解压并整合所有分卷后,用户可以通过执行`eclipse.exe`来启动Eclipse,并根据个人需求进行配置和...

    Weblogic目录结构

    ### Weblogic目录结构详解 #### 一、BEA主目录结构 Weblogic的主目录结构是整个Weblogic服务器的基础框架,包含了系统运行所必需的各种组件和工具。具体来说,包括以下关键目录: - **jdk目录**:此目录存放的是...

    删除eclipse3.4的configuration目录导致eclipse无法启动的解决办法

    - 学习Eclipse的工作原理和基本结构,了解哪些文件夹和文件是不可删除的。 - 避免随意删除或修改Eclipse的关键文件和目录。 3. **使用官方文档** - 在进行任何可能影响Eclipse稳定性的操作前,查阅Eclipse的...

    源码说明1

    3.2.2. Eclipse目录结构说明 Eclipse的项目结构相对简单,`src`下直接存放Java源代码,`res`用于放置资源,如XML布局文件和图片。 3.3. APP配置文件说明 无论是iOS的`Info.plist`还是Android的`AndroidManifest.xml...

    Android代码-Android-GetAPKInfo

    目录结构 ├── AndroidGetSignature.apk : 一款基于Android Studio开发的通过包名获取apk签名的应用 │ ├── AndroidGetSignature : AndroidGetSignature.apk对应源码 │ ├── AXMLPrinter2_zixie.jar :对于...

    tomcat web开发及整合

    **知识点5:Eclipse目录结构解析** - **plugins**:存储所有插件的目录,包括Eclipse自带插件和第三方插件。 - **features**:存放功能组件,这些组件可以提供特定的功能或服务。 - **links**:存放指向其他plugins...

    wtp-jem-sdk-R-1.5.4-200705021353.zip

    从压缩包子文件的文件名称 "eclipse" 来看,这表明包内的内容可能是基于 Eclipse 平台构建的,因为 Eclipse 通常使用 "eclipse" 目录结构来组织其插件和组件。在 MyEclipse 中,这样的更新通常会覆盖到特定的插件或...

    Myclipse工程变成Eclipse工程

    这时,可以尝试将Myclipse的lib目录下的额外JAR文件添加到Eclipse工程,或者直接导入到Eclipse的构建路径中。 9. **浏览器兼容性**:确保你的应用能在目标浏览器中正常工作。这里提到了IE8,这意味着你的应用应该...

    Eclipse平台体系结构分析

    Eclipse平台体系结构分析,一篇很好的解析Eclipse结构的文档,对了解eclipse有很大的帮助

Global site tag (gtag.js) - Google Analytics